Cognizant (NASDAQ: CTSH) has introduced its latest innovation, the Cognizant Agent Foundry, a comprehensive platform designed to assist enterprises in implementing and scaling autonomous AI agents. This platform aims to accelerate the deployment across organizations by utilizing domain-specific small language models, industrialized agent templates, and a pre-built library of proprietary agents.
The deployment of AI agents through Cognizant Agent Foundry follows a structured four-stage process: Discover, Design, Build, and Scale. This systematic approach integrates with major enterprise systems and AI platforms, benefiting from collaborations with leading technology firms like ServiceNow, Salesforce, and WRITER.
Agent Foundry is designed to support both horizontal business functions, such as customer service and marketing, and industry-specific operations like claims adjudication and regulatory reporting. It ensures compliance with crucial regulations including GDPR, HIPAA, and the EU AI Act, paving the way for secure and responsible AI deployment in various sectors.
The modular composition of the platform allows for flexibility and customization, making it easier for enterprises to transition from AI experimentation to execution.
